Advertisement
Place your ad here.
Ren Sushi The Well
Wellington Market, 486 Front St W unit wm56, Toronto, ON M5V 0V2, Canada
Toronto, Canada
Rating: 6
Score: 4.7
Price:
No reviews available.
Place your ad here.
Wellington Market, 486 Front St W unit wm56, Toronto, ON M5V 0V2, Canada
Toronto, Canada
Rating: 6
Score: 4.7
Price:
No reviews available.